FOCUS ON THE PAST 
Visions of Eight Selections from the Attleboro Arts Museum’s Permanent Collection
Attleboro Arts Museum, 86 Park Street, Attleboro, MA
Exhibition: February 7 – 28, 2026
Opening Reception: Saturday, February 7, 2pm-4pm. Free and open to all. RSVPs are appreciated: office@attleboroartsmuseum.org

Focus on the Past marries the talent of contemporary artists with highlights from the Attleboro Arts Museum’s collection. Each participating artist has selected one of eight collection items and has responded to that holding with an original work in their current style and chosen medium. 

The artists were not prompted to create replicas. Instead, they were given the opportunity to use a holding as inspiration for creating a new work that tapped into their personal visual language and point of view.
